SMO Principles

• Increase your linkability• Make tagging and bookmarking

easy• Reward inbound links• Help your content travel• Encourage the mashup

(source: Rohit Bhargava)

Page 8: Social Media (SMO) & SEO Interaction

Increase Linkability

• What does it mean?– Make people want to link to

your content• How do you use SEO?:

– Target page content– Optimize for relevancy– Distribute/place keyterms – Suggest anchor text– Contribute content– Link to resources

Page 9: Social Media (SMO) & SEO Interaction

Tagging / Bookmarking

• What does it mean?– Add features so others can find/share content

• How do you use SEO?:– Keyterms in tags– Categorize tags– Associate tags– Semantic Taxonomy

Page 10: Social Media (SMO) & SEO Interaction

Reward Inbound Links• What does it mean?

– Reciprocate links/tags (note: there is a proper SEO way to do this)

• How do you use SEO?:– Find relevant pages– Focus on anchor text– Use “nofollow” properly

Page 11: Social Media (SMO) & SEO Interaction

Help Content Travel• What does it mean?

– Don’t just focus on your site• How do you use SEO?:

– Optimizing media (audio/video/etc.)– Relevant sites to share/submit/syndicate– Optimize incoming links– Use microformats

Page 12: Social Media (SMO) & SEO Interaction

Encourage Mashup• What does it mean?

– Co-creating content/sharing• How do you use SEO?:

– Share optimized content– Keep control of SEO elements– Track user/visitor/creator use
